I'm wondering the same thing. We have never gone in the summer but we expect the hours will increase due to crowds.
 
They just updated April hours, like two days ago.

They update about 2 weeks out now.

Those June hours will be updated mid May. Most likely closing will be at 11 PM. Not as great as the midnight to 1 AM closings we used to see, but still better than 9!

And this is why they no longer do them. Very light attendance. I agree, we are late night people, would rather stay out late, sleep late. But the reason it worked was not very many people prefer that. So it was no cost effective to do. They now close at a time when the majority are calling it quits. I'd love to see the late hours return but I don't expect it
